Changelog — Fabrikit 2.1 (welcome, new folks). The setting formerly called SEED_DB_PASS has been renamed FACTORY_SEED_CREDENTIAL to match our naming convention for test-data factory secrets. Old env files keep working through 2.3, but you'll see a startup warning. Migration is a one-line edit. Place the renamed entry on the line immediately after this sentence.

env line for fafof-fahag: LEDGER_TOKEN5=f8790

## Blue-Green Deploy: Billing Worker (Meridex)

1. Confirm green pool is drained. Check the Pulsegate dashboard — zero in-flight invoices.
2. Deploy new build to green via Shipline. Wait for health checks (3 consecutive passes).
3. Flip traffic weight 10% → 50% → 100%, five minutes between steps.
4. Watch dead-letter queue. Any spike: flip back to blue immediately.
5. Keep blue warm for 24 hours before teardown.

Before step 2, verify the worker can reach the ledger database. Use the staging connection string below.

primary connection of kawep-yafop = mssql://briion_svc:9sCH3kS@db-24ce.orvexcloud.internal:5432/ulair

Revised Sales-Commission Scheme (Managers Only)

This page summarises the restructured commission model for Veltrix Systems, approved in principle by the remuneration committee. Base rates fall to 4%, offset by accelerators above 110% of quota, effective next quarter. Transitional protection applies for two cycles. The confidential business-plan note appears immediately below.

internal memo for kawip-hadug: Headcount on the Wenwyn team goes from 7 to 140 by the end of January. Gross margin on Wenwyn came in at 20 percent against a plan of 15 percent.

Runbook — restoring the ops account for soft-delete cleanup (Orchavo orders table).

So the cleanup job runs under a service account, and if it gets locked, soft-deleted orders pile up past the 30-day purge window. Don't hard-delete anything by hand. Instead, re-activate the account via the Tilbrook admin shell, re-grant the purge role, and rerun the sweep in dry-run first. The shell will ask for the account's recovery passphrase, which is below.

vault phrase of tajop-haduf = holath-brivan-wenax